Evolution Mechanism of Meandering River Downstream Gigantic Hydraulic Project I: Hydrodynamic Models and Verification

Abstract: The evolution mechanism of meandering river is one of essential references to predict the evolution disciplines of meandering river. Jingjiang curved reaches are the typical meandering river; more specifically, they are located downstream the gigantic hydraulic project named Three Gorge Project (TGP). Because the incoming water and sediment condition have been changed by the gigantic project, the evolution behavior of Jingjiang curved reaches changes a lot, making the evolution behavior unpredictable. “…The previous paper (Liu et al 2018) has studied that the evolution behaviors of the Jingjiang reach can be divided into two types. In Type-A, before TGR impoundment, the concave bank was scoured, while the convex bank was deposited; after the impoundment, the reverse happened, namely, the concave bank was deposited, while the convex bank was scoured.…”
